EV Charging Test Engineer

Torrance, CA (100% on-site)

Duration: initial 7-month contract (W2 not eligible for C2C)

Pay:$44-49/hr




We are seeking an experienced EV Charging Test Engineer to support the development, validation, and testing of electric vehicle charging systems and components. This role requires hands-on experience with high-voltage electrical systems, test instrumentation, data acquisition, and troubleshooting. The ideal candidate will play a key role in planning, executing, and analyzing tests while supporting root cause investigations and continuous product improvement.




Key Responsibilities

  • Develop and support test plans, test procedures, and validation activities for EV charging systems and components.
  • Execute testing and analyze performance data to verify system functionality and reliability.
  • Install and configure test instrumentation, including thermocouples, voltage probes, current transducers, and data acquisition equipment.
  • Create and maintain technical documentation, including test procedures, specifications, engineering drawings, and verification plans.
  • Design, build, and modify test fixtures and instrumentation required for charging equipment validation.
  • Perform hands-on testing and troubleshooting of electrical and charging systems.
  • Support root cause analysis efforts and drive resolution of issues identified during testing.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ional engineering teams to ensure successful test execution and product validation.

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, or a related technical discipline from an accredited university.
  • Minimum of 2 years of experience in a test engineering, validation engineering, or similar technical role.
  • Experience executing and maintaining system-level and component-level test programs.
  • Strong hands-on hardware testing and troubleshooting skills.
  • Experience working with medium- and high-voltage electrical systems up to 1000 VDC.
  • Proficiency with data acquisition systems, data loggers, and test instrumentation.
  • Ability to work independently and manage multiple testing activities with minimal supervision.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and technical documentation skills.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ience testing EV charging systems, power electronics, battery systems, or related automotive technologies.
  • Familiarity with electrical safety practices and high-voltage testing environments.
  • Experience designing custom test fixtures and validation equipment.
